Jaipur to Singapore Trip Cost
The total cost of a Singapore holiday from Jaipur depends on your travel dates, airfare, hotel category, number of travellers, sightseeing and attraction tickets.
For a typical 4-night/5-day Singapore holiday, these are useful indicative planning ranges:
| Package TypeApprox. Budget Per Person | |
| Budget | ₹45,000–₹65,000 |
| Standard | ₹60,000–₹90,000 |
| Premium | ₹90,000–₹1.30 lakh+ |
| Luxury | ₹1.30 lakh+ |
These are approximate planning ranges and not fixed package prices. Actual costs can vary according to flight and hotel availability, season and booking date.

Jaipur to Singapore – 4 Nights / 5 Days Itinerary
Day 1 – Jaipur to Singapore
Travel from Jaipur to Singapore according to your selected flight schedule.
After arriving at Changi Airport, complete the arrival formalities and transfer to your hotel.
Check in and keep the evening relaxed after your journey.
Day 2 – Singapore City Tour & Gardens by the Bay
Start your Singapore holiday with a city sightseeing tour.
Visit popular landmarks such as:
- Merlion Park
- Marina Bay
- Chinatown
- Little India
- Kampong Glam
Later, visit Gardens by the Bay and explore the Supertrees, Flower Dome and Cloud Forest.
Day 3 – Sentosa Island
Spend the day exploring Sentosa Island.
Popular activities and attractions include:
- Singapore Oceanarium
- Cable Car
- Luge
- Beach activities
- Dining experiences
Day 4 – Universal Studios Singapore
Spend a full day at Universal Studios Singapore.
Families can enjoy rides and themed attractions, while couples and adults can spend the evening shopping or dining.
Day 5 – Singapore to Jaipur
Enjoy breakfast and some free time depending on your return flight.
Transfer to Changi Airport for your journey back to Jaipur.

Indian Food in Singapore
Travellers from Jaipur can easily find Indian food in Singapore.
Popular options include:
- North Indian cuisine
- Rajasthani food
- Vegetarian meals
- Jain-friendly options
- Biryani
- Thali
- Indian snacks
- Indian sweets
Little India is particularly popular for Indian cuisine, while Indian restaurants can also be found throughout Singapore.
If you have specific dietary requirements, mention them while planning your holiday.
Where to Stay in Singapore
Choosing the right hotel location can make sightseeing easier.
Consider staying near an MRT station or in a well-connected area.
Little India
A convenient choice for Indian food, shopping and transport connections.
Bugis
A central area with shopping, dining and easy access to public transportation.
Lavender
A popular area with a range of hotels and good transport connectivity.
Orchard Road
A good option for travellers interested in shopping and premium hotels.
How to Save Money on a Jaipur to Singapore Trip
Compare Departure Airports
Compare Jaipur with other nearby departure options if travelling to another airport is practical.
Book Early
Early planning can provide more choices of flights and hotels.
Choose a Well-Connected Hotel
Staying near an MRT station can reduce daily travel time and transportation costs.
Plan Attractions by Location
Group nearby attractions together to reduce unnecessary travel.
Compare Complete Package Inclusions
Don't compare packages only by the headline price. Check whether the package includes:
- Breakfast
- Airport transfers
- Sightseeing
- Attraction tickets
- Hotel taxes
- Other mandatory charges
